**Alert: tailfox CLI — tail session failures**

The tailfox CLI is failing to open tail sessions against the Greymarsh log brokers. Error rate above 30% for 15 minutes. Release impact: deploy verification relies on live tails, so holds may be needed. Workaround: use the batch-pull mode until sessions recover. Triage steps and current broker status are tracked on the page below.

dashboard of bajef-bageg = https://confluence.lumiclabs.internal/browse/browse/pages/display/93ae

Hey Marta — quick handover before I head off. Vexley Couriers missed the 14:00 pick-up at the Brindlewood depot again, second time this month, so Tomas has switched us over to Quillhart Express starting tomorrow. Their driver will come to the side dock, not the front gate, usually between 10 and 11. Paperwork's the same, just stamp the manifest twice. The Ellsworth parcel from accounts is still sitting in the cage and needs to go out first thing. When the Quillhart driver arrives, give them the following instruction:

dispatch memo: the lamwyn fenwyn courier leaves the wenir ledger at gate 7175 under passcode 822969

Handover: Ashgate admin dashboard dark mode

Dark mode shipped behind the `theme_dark` flag, enabled for staff only. Known gaps: charts ignore the palette, and the audit-log table flashes white on load. Fix branch for the flash is up, unreviewed. Token overrides live in `themes/dusk.json`; don't edit component CSS directly. Flag flip for all tenants is planned next sprint — hold if the chart issue isn't closed. Questions during on-call go to the person named below.

account owner for bawip-tahag: Raleth Quenok